three of this stylish cargo liners were under the italian company from 1972-1980.
the glourious ITALIA DI NAVIGAZIONE they were DA NOLI ex BENLEDI-
DA VERRAZZANO ex BENALBANACH-and DA RECCO ex BENWYVIS.
